Question
If you live in an overcrowded and poorly ventilated house, it is possible that you may suffer from which of the following diseases
Options
Cancer
AIDS
Airborne diseases
Cholera
Advertisements
Solution
Airborne diseases
Explanation:
In overcrowded and poorly ventilated conditions, airborne diseases are likely to spread rapidly. This is because infectious microbes that cause the common cold, tuberculosis, pneumonia, etc. can spread through the air from infected persons. The infected person throws out little droplets on sneezing, coughing or spitting. Someone standing closely can breathe in these droplets and, thus, microbes get a chance to start a new infection in this person.
